Q: What is the X9317ZS8I-2.7? A: The X9317ZS8I-2.7 is a digitally controlled potentiometer (XDCP) that can be used for various applications in electronic circuits.
Q: What is the operating voltage range of X9317ZS8I-2.7? A: The operating voltage range of X9317ZS8I-2.7 is typically between 2.7V and 5.5V.
Q: How does X9317ZS8I-2.7 work? A: X9317ZS8I-2.7 works by digitally controlling the resistance value using a serial interface, allowing precise adjustment of resistance in electronic circuits.
Q: What is the resolution of X9317ZS8I-2.7? A: The X9317ZS8I-2.7 has a resolution of 64 taps, which means it can provide 64 different resistance values.
Q: Can X9317ZS8I-2.7 be used as a volume control in audio applications? A: Yes, X9317ZS8I-2.7 can be used as a volume control in audio applications, providing precise adjustment of audio levels.
Q: Is X9317ZS8I-2.7 suitable for use in battery-powered devices? A: Yes, X9317ZS8I-2.7 is suitable for use in battery-powered devices as it operates within a low voltage range.
Q: Can X9317ZS8I-2.7 be used in digital-to-analog converter (DAC) circuits? A: Yes, X9317ZS8I-2.7 can be used in DAC circuits to control the output voltage or current.
Q: What is the temperature range for X9317ZS8I-2.7? A: The temperature range for X9317ZS8I-2.7 is typically between -40°C and 85°C.
Q: Can X9317ZS8I-2.7 be used in industrial automation applications? A: Yes, X9317ZS8I-2.7 can be used in industrial automation applications where precise resistance adjustment is required.
